4. Setup and Initial Use

4.1 Charging the Keyboard

Before first use, it is recommended to fully charge the keyboard. The AK980 features an 8000mAh lithium battery for extended use.

8000mAh lithium battery details and charging instructions

Figure 2: Battery life and charging instructions.

Charging Instructions:

  1. It is recommended to charge the keyboard using only the computer's USB port.
  2. Do not use fast-charging phone chargers to charge the keyboard.
  3. Do not use inferior non-standard power adapters to charge the keyboard.
  4. Do not use over-voltage or over-current power adapters to charge the keyboard.
  5. Keep away from high-temperature devices while charging.
  6. The indicator light will be on while charging and turn off when fully charged.
  7. Turn off the power switch when not in use for a long time.

Expected battery life: Approximately 28 hours of wireless use, or up to 110 hours with backlight off.

4.2 Connecting the Keyboard

The AK980 supports three connection modes: 2.4G Wireless, Bluetooth 5.0, and USB-C Wired.

3 Modes Connectivity diagram and supported systems

Figure 3: Connectivity modes and compatible devices.

Side Switches:

On the side of the keyboard, you will find switches to control the operating system mode and connection type.

Side function keys for easy control (MAC/WIN switch, 2.4G/USB/BT switch, USB-C port)

Figure 4: Side switches for OS and connection mode.

  • MAC/WIN Switch: Toggle between Mac and Windows operating system layouts.
  • 2.4G/USB/BT Switch: Select your desired connection mode.

2.4G Wireless Mode:

  1. Set the side switch to '2.4G'.
  2. Press FN + R on the keyboard.
  3. Plug the 2.4G USB receiver into your computer's USB port. The keyboard should connect automatically.

Bluetooth 5.0 Mode:

  1. Set the side switch to 'BT'.
  2. Press and hold FN + Q, FN + W, or FN + E to enter pairing mode for one of the three Bluetooth channels. The TFT screen will indicate pairing status.
  3. On your device (PC, laptop, tablet, mobile phone), search for Bluetooth devices and select 'Ajazz AK980' to pair.
  4. You can pair up to three Bluetooth devices and switch between them using FN + Q, FN + W, or FN + E.

USB-C Wired Mode:

  1. Set the side switch to 'USB'.
  2. Connect the provided USB-C cable from the keyboard to your computer's USB port.
  3. The keyboard will be recognized as a wired device.

5. Operating Instructions

5.1 TFT Color Screen

The 1.14-inch TFT color display provides real-time information about your keyboard's status.

Close-up of 1.14-inch TFT color screen and metal knob functions

Figure 5: TFT Color Screen displaying status and knob functions.

It can display:

  • Current time and date
  • Connection mode (2.4G, BT1, BT2, BT3, USB)
  • Battery level
  • Active lighting effects
  • Custom GIF animations (configurable via driver software)

5.2 Metal Knob Functions

The metal knob located on the top right of the keyboard offers quick control over various functions:

  • Volume Control: Rotate clockwise for Volume+, counter-clockwise for Volume-. Press to Pause/Play.
  • Page Scrolling: Can be configured for scrolling pages.
  • Handy Shortcuts: Customizable shortcuts via driver software.

5.3 RGB Backlight Control

The keyboard features 16.8 million color RGB backlighting with 20 different lighting effects.

16.8M RGB Backlight with 20 lighting effects and FN key combinations

Figure 6: RGB Backlight controls.

  • FN + ↑/↓: Adjust Light Brightness
  • FN + X: Switch Light On/Off
  • FN + 1/2@/3#: Customize Lighting Modes (specific modes may vary or be configurable via software)

6. Maintenance

6.1 Cleaning

To clean your keyboard:

  1. Disconnect the keyboard from your computer (if wired) or turn it off (if wireless).
  2. Use a soft, lint-free cloth slightly dampened with water or a mild cleaning solution to wipe down the keycaps and case.
  3. For dust and debris between keys, use compressed air.
  4. Avoid spraying liquids directly onto the keyboard.

6.2 Hot-Swappable Switches

The AK980 features a hot-swappable PCB, allowing you to easily change mechanical switches without soldering.

Hot-swappable PCB with switch removal tool

Figure 7: Hot-swappable switch replacement.

Replacing Switches:

  1. Use the provided switch puller tool to gently grip the switch and pull it straight up.
  2. Align the pins of the new switch with the holes on the PCB.
  3. Gently press the new switch into place until it clicks. Ensure the pins are not bent.

6.3 Keycap Replacement

The PBT keycaps can also be removed and replaced.

Replacing Keycaps:

  1. Use the provided keycap puller tool to gently pull the keycap straight up.
  2. Align the new keycap with the switch stem and press down firmly until it is seated.

7. Troubleshooting

Keyboard Not Responding:

  • Ensure the keyboard is charged.
  • Check the connection mode switch (2.4G/USB/BT) is set correctly.
  • If in wired mode, ensure the USB-C cable is securely connected to both the keyboard and the computer.
  • If in 2.4G mode, ensure the USB receiver is plugged in and the keyboard is set to 2.4G mode (FN+R).
  • If in Bluetooth mode, ensure it's paired correctly and selected the right channel (FN+Q/W/E). Try re-pairing if issues persist.

Charging Issues:

  • Refer to the detailed charging instructions in Section 4.1. Ensure you are using a standard USB port for charging and avoiding fast chargers.

TFT Screen Not Displaying Correctly:

  • Ensure the keyboard is powered on.
  • If custom GIFs are not displaying, verify they were uploaded correctly via the driver software.

Keys Not Registering or Double-Typing:

  • This could indicate a faulty switch. Utilize the hot-swappable feature to replace the problematic switch (refer to Section 6.2).

Layout Issues (e.g., 'ñ' key):

  • The Ajazz AK980 is typically manufactured with an English (US) layout. If you require a specific regional layout (e.g., Spanish with 'ñ'), please verify product specifications before purchase. Software remapping might be an option for some keys, but physical keycaps would remain English.

8.1 Switch Specifications

Multiple flagship switches available with specifications for Hyacinth switch and Merrard switch

Figure 9: Hyacinth and Merrard Switch Specifications.

Switch specifications for Gift switch V2, Cyan cloud switch, and TTC Flame Red switch V2

Figure 10: Gift V2, Cyan Cloud, and TTC Flame Red Switch Specifications.

Switch TypeTotal TravelOperating TravelOperating ForceTermination Force
Gift Switch V23.3mm ± 0.2mm2.0mm ± 0.4mm45gf ± 8gf60gf ± 8gf
Cyan Cloud Switch3.2mm ± 0.4mm2.0mm ± 0.4mm48gf ± 10gf55gf ± 10gf
TTC Flame Red Switch V23.6mm ± 0.3mm2.0mm ± 0.6mm45gf ± 5gf53gf ± 5gf
Hyacinth Switch3.5mm ± 0.3mm1.9mm ± 0.3mm45gf ± 5gf52gf ± 5gf
Merrard Switch3.5mm ± 0.5mm1.6mm ± 0.5mm50gf ± 10gf56gf ± 10gf
